Spirobranchus cariniferus, commonly known as the blue tubeworm or spiny tubeworm, or by its Māori name toke pā, is a species of tube-building polychaete worm endemic to New Zealand.[1][2][3]
This species forms patchy, belt-like colonies of hard, white, triangular tubes, each containing a bright blue worm. These are cemented to the shaded side of rocks in the lower to mid-tidal zone. It may also inhabit hard objects such as dead shells and small stones. When submerged, it puts out a fan of dark-blue tentacles to feed, which it retracts during low tide.[1][2][4]
Individuals living in Dunedin's Otago Harbour are the only polychaetes known to host gregarine parasites. Little is known about their impact on the worms, but it is likely to be a negative one.[5]
Adult worms can grow to 40 mm long and 3 mm wide.[2] The tube is hard, white, and triangular in cross-section with a ridge running along the top. This extends from above the tube opening to form a sharp protective spine. The operculum is a flat, calcareous plate. Its stalk is flat with prolonged wings.[1][2] Its body is a yellow to orange colour towards the posterior and a bright blue at the anterior. Radioles are a bright to dark blue with some white bands. The blue tubeworm is a surface filter feeder. It feeds on plankton and organic particles, which it filters from the water using its fan of tentacles.[1][6][7]
It is found throughout New Zealand.[1] Its tube layers can be up to 30 cm thick in the cooler climate of the South Island.[2]
